Ashby ponds Living. is looking for a Housekeeping Team Lead to support our gated retirement community. All of our clients live within our community so there is no travel involved!

How you will make an impact:

Providing leadership, direction, and support to the Housekeepers under the guidance of the Housekeeping Supervisor and Housekeeping Manager.

Maintaining the cleanliness and safety of assigned areas.

Completing assigned work orders, and following a detailed schedule.

May be asked to assist with set-ups, requiring movement of furniture.

Scheduling and supervising daily work assignments.

Training, mentoring, and coaching new employees.

What you will need:

One to three years’ experience in Housekeeping.

Previous experience in a leadership role (preferred) must have excellent; customer service, communication and problem solving skills.

Ability to work independently and as a contributing team member.

Ability to use and operate all required equipment.

Ability to demonstrate professional and responsive interactions with residents and their family members, staff, vendors and each other.

Strong knowledge of Housekeeping operations.

Ability to lead and motivate a team.
